CAS 474918-32-6
:2-Bromo-9,9-diphenylfluorene
Description:
2-Bromo-9,9-diphenylfluorene is an organic compound characterized by its unique structure, which includes a fluorene backbone substituted with two phenyl groups and a bromine atom at the 2-position. This compound typically exhibits a high degree of stability due to the conjugated system of the fluorene structure, which can contribute to its electronic properties. It is often used in organic synthesis and materials science, particularly in the development of organic semiconductors and light-emitting devices. The presence of the bromine atom can enhance its reactivity, making it a useful intermediate in various chemical reactions, including cross-coupling reactions. Additionally, 2-bromo-9,9-diphenylfluorene may display interesting photophysical properties, such as fluorescence, which can be exploited in optoelectronic applications. Its solubility and stability in organic solvents make it suitable for various laboratory applications. As with many brominated compounds, it is important to handle it with care due to potential environmental and health impacts associated with bromine-containing substances.
